文档首页/ 对象存储服务 OBS/ SDK参考/ BrowserJS/ 桶相关接口/ 归档直读/ 设置桶归档存储对象直读策略
更新时间:2026-05-28 GMT+08:00
分享

设置桶归档存储对象直读策略

功能说明

设置桶的归档存储对象直读策略。

接口约束

  • 您必须是桶拥有者或拥有设置桶归档存储对象直读策略的权限,才能设置桶归档存储对象直读策略。建议使用IAM或桶策略进行授权,如果使用IAM则需授予obs:bucket:PutDirectColdAccessConfiguration权限,如果使用桶策略则需授予PutDirectColdAccessConfiguration权限。相关授权方式介绍可参见OBS权限控制概述,配置方式详见使用IAM自定义策略自定义创建桶策略
  • OBS支持的region以及region与endPoint的对应关系,详细信息请参见地区与终端节点

方法定义

ObsClient.setBucketDirectColdAccess(params)

请求参数说明

表1 请求参数列表

参数名称

参数类型

是否必选

描述

Bucket

String

必选

参数解释

桶名。

约束限制:

  • 桶的名字需全局唯一,不能与已有的任何桶名称重复,包括其他用户创建的桶。
  • 桶命名规则如下:
    • 3~63个字符,数字或字母开头,支持小写字母、数字、“-”、“.”。
    • 禁止使用IP地址。
    • 禁止以“-”或“.”开头及结尾。
    • 禁止两个“.”相邻(如:“my..bucket”)。
    • 禁止“.”和“-”相邻(如:“my-.bucket”和“my.-bucket”)。
  • 同一用户在同一个区域多次创建同名桶不会报错,创建的桶属性以第一次请求为准。

默认取值:

Status

String

可选

参数解释:

桶的归档直读策略。

取值范围:

  • Enabled:开启桶归档存储对象直读策略。
  • Disabled:不开启桶归档存储对象直读策略。

默认取值:

返回结果说明

表2 ICommonMsg

参数名称

参数类型

描述

Status

number

参数解释:

OBS服务端返回的HTTP状态码。

取值范围:

状态码是一组从2xx(成功)到4xx或5xx(错误)的数字代码,状态码表示了请求响应的状态。完整的状态码列表请参见状态码

Code

string

参数解释:

OBS服务端返回的错误码。

Message

string

参数解释:

OBS服务端返回的错误描述。

HostId

string

参数解释:

OBS服务端返回的请求服务端ID。

RequestId

string

参数解释:

OBS服务端返回的请求ID。

Id2

string

参数解释:

OBS服务端返回的请求ID2。

Indicator

string

参数解释:

OBS服务端返回的详细错误码。

相关文档